Identifying Off-Season Opportunities


When it comes to weddings, timing can play a crucial role in your budget. Research indicates that the most affordable months to tie the knot in the USA are January, February, and late October into November. These months are considered off-season, which leads to lower demand for wedding services. That translates to potentially lower costs for you. On the flip side, December is often pricier due to the holiday season, while March and April, although affordable, come with unpredictable weather.

The consensus is that January stands out as the most budget-friendly month to get married. One key advantage is that January falls outside the popular wedding season, which means venues and vendors often have more availability and are willing to negotiate on price. Additionally, the post-holiday retail environment offers sales on decor and attire, making it a prime time to secure deals on various wedding-related items. Moreover, with fewer weddings scheduled in January, vendors and venues can give your celebration the focused attention it deserves, leading to a more personalized experience.

Maximizing Off-Season Advantages


Choosing to get married in the off-season opens up a variety of cost-saving strategies:


  • Date Flexibility: When you choose an off-season date, many venues and vendors are less booked. This provides you with the flexibility to negotiate better rates. Additionally, weeknight weddings become a viable option for even more savings.


  • Venue Choices: Off-season months often see a dip in demand for mainstream venues. This opens up the opportunity for unique settings. A non-typical Charleston wedding venue like a community center or farm can also give your celebration a distinct flavor without the high cost that peak seasons often carry.


  • Guest List Management: When choosing an off-season date, you may find that not everyone can attend. Although this may initially seem disappointing, it actually provides a natural way to reduce your guest list. Fewer guests mean lower costs for food, seating, and decor.


  • Resourcefulness: Off-season weddings are a great time to get creative. Many people marry in peak months, so it's easier to find gently-used, low-cost decor from friends or on social media platforms tailored for weddings.


  • DIY Approach: When demand for professionals is low, it’s a good time for those wondering how to set up a wedding ceremony to take the DIY route. Crafting your own decorations can be an effective and personalized cost-saving measure during the off-season.


  • Price Negotiations: Vendors are often more willing to negotiate during less busy months. Being upfront about your budget and what you can afford helps vendors tailor their services to your needs, often at a reduced rate.


  • Enlisting Help: During the off-season, friends and family may have more availability to lend a helping hand. Utilizing the skills of a creative aunt for floral arrangements or a talented cousin for makeup can add a personal touch while saving money.


Applying these strategies allows you to organize a memorable event without breaking the bank.


Tips for Off-Season Outdoor Weddings


Are you planning an off-season wedding outdoors? Weather can be a significant concern. Outdoor wedding venues in Charleston, SC, often offer both indoor and outdoor options, which is a sensible choice for unpredictable conditions. Tents can protect your guests from adverse weather and offer a cozy atmosphere. Ensure you and your guests dress accordingly—extra shawls or jackets may be necessary. Another factor to consider is adequate lighting, especially with shorter daylight hours in the off-season. Last but not least, always have a backup plan. Weather is unpredictable, but your preparedness doesn't have to be.


The Pros and Cons


Benefits


Getting married during the off-season comes with several advantages:


  • Better Availability: Off-season weddings mean less competition for dates, venues, and vendors.


  • Cost Savings: Vendors may offer discounted rates during low-demand months. Additionally, your guests might save on travel and accommodations.



  • Decor Freedom: Lower demand allows for more creativity in terms of decor and themes.


  • Unique Anniversaries: An off-season date ensures your anniversary is distinctive.


  • Less Crowding: Fewer weddings happening simultaneously means less stress about overlapping bookings.


Drawbacks


However, there are challenges:


  • Seasonal flowers and food might take more work to obtain.


  • Guests may find it difficult to attend due to financial or scheduling constraints.


  • Risks of weather-related disruptions like snowstorms are higher.


Negotiation Tips for Off-Season Weddings


When planning an off-season wedding, negotiating with vendors is essential. After all, it’s probably a big reason you’re avoiding peak wedding seasons. 


  • Be Upfront About Budget: Clearly state your budget at the outset of discussions. This aligns expectations on both sides, enabling vendors to offer options that fit within your financial framework. It also saves time by eliminating choices that are out of your reach.


  • Research Market Prices: Before negotiating, research the current market prices for the services you need. Remember, the average wedding in the USA costs almost $30 thousand, but prices vary. Doing your research ahead of time ensures you're coming from a position of knowledge, which can be incredibly empowering in negotiations. You'll know if a given quote is fair or if there's room for bargaining.


  • Show Flexibility in Off-Season Choices: Off-season weddings offer the advantage of greater availability, but they also come with some limitations, like seasonal unavailability of certain foods or flowers. Being open to different venue types, decor options, and catering menus can lead to cost savings. For example, if you're flexible about your food choices, you can opt for readily available seasonal ingredients. Some vendors might pivot to other services during slow months, so their usual offerings may be limited. Being adaptable opens up new avenues for savings and unique choices.


  • Consider Bundling Services: Using one vendor for multiple needs, such as catering and decorations, might lead to discounted package deals. This could save you money and simplify logistics by dealing with fewer vendors.
